Well, it's been several years since I was in college, but I remember those boring classes. The worst one for me was Trigonometry and Analytical Geometry (which wasn't that boring except that it was a five hour night class). We met from 5:00 in the evening and got out at 10:00 at night with only one fifteen minute break. It was torture for me. Here are some of the things I did. I brought along reading material that related to an interest. I worked on writing. I drew pictures or designs in the margins of my math notes. I sat next to the window so I had a clear view of a traffic light. I would note by making hash marks on paper how many times the light changed. I also timed the duration of the green/yellow/red light progressions and noted how it changed according to rush hour traffic and late evening traffic. Pretty sad wasn't it? But it got me through. Basically, I just found something passive that got me through.
